Understanding Green Low Temperature Purification: Innovations in Cooling Technology

Green Low Temperature Purification is an emerging technology that focuses on the purification processes conducted at lower temperatures, significantly enhancing the efficiency and sustainability of industrial cooling systems. In industries where temperature control is paramount, such as in chemical manufacturing or food processing, adopting such green technologies can lead to substantial improvements in both product quality and energy consumption.
At its core, Green Low Temperature Purification utilizes innovative cooling techniques that operate optimally at lower temperatures. This approach minimizes energy usage, as traditional purification processes often require high temperatures, which lead to increased energy costs and higher emissions. By employing cooler temperatures, businesses can not only reduce their carbon footprint but also save on operational costs.
One significant aspect of this technology is its ability to integrate with existing cooling systems, particularly in heat exchangers and coolers. When traditional methods are replaced or supplemented with low-temperature purification techniques, the overall efficiency of heat transfer can be enhanced. This can result in better thermal management, preventing overheating and reducing wear and tear on industrial equipment. Consequently, companies can experience longer equipment lifespans and lower maintenance costs.
The applications of Green Low Temperature Purification are broad and diverse. For instance, in refrigeration systems, this technology can improve the effectiveness of cooling cycles, leading to reduced energy demands. In the context of wastewater treatment, low-temperature processes can facilitate the removal of contaminants without the need for energy-intensive heating methods. This makes it an attractive option for industries aiming to adopt more environmentally friendly practices.
Furthermore, as regulations regarding emissions and energy consumption become more stringent, businesses are increasingly motivated to adopt greener technologies. By implementing Green Low Temperature Purification, companies can align with sustainability goals and regulatory requirements while also appealing to environmentally conscious consumers.
